Webhere. If the practice performance is below the benchmark, the difference is applied to the denominator plus exceptions to demonstrate potential gains on a practice basis. The potential gains on a CCG basis are calculated based on the difference between the top 5 performing closest CCGs and the selected CCG, applied to the denominator plus ...
